That is correct. As stock or pets, they are lovely additions to your flock. If you want to breed them or otherwise become more familiar with the key features of the Cream Legbar breed, then the Cream Legbar Club Website has the draft Standard of Perfection (SOP) that anyone can access and review. As a complex color pattern, and newly introduced breed, CL breeders have a number of items to work on within their breeding lines. Meanwhile, a healthy chicken is a healthy chicken, regardless of anything else.
